Average FPS: resolution vs quality settings
| Ultra | High | Medium | Low | |
|---|---|---|---|---|
| 4K Ultra HD | 33 | 47 | 60 | 77 |
| 1440p QHD | 57 | 83 | 105 | 136 |
| 1080p Full HD | 85 | 123 | 157 | 203 |
Cell color: green is 120+ FPS, teal is 60+, amber is 30+, red is below 30.

Settings Recommendations
The measured FPS data suggests that the "High" preset offers the most balanced experience for this hardware combination, particularly at 1440p and 4K resolutions. At 2560x1440, the High preset delivers an average of 83 FPS, which is comfortably above the 60 FPS threshold for smooth gameplay. The jump from High to Ultra at this resolution is punishing, dropping the average to 57 FPS, a significant 26 FPS reduction that may not justify the visual gain. The data indicates that Ultra settings are reserved for lower resolutions, as the 1080p Ultra average of 85 FPS is still playable but suggests that the GPU is working near its limits.
For users prioritizing frame rate above all else, the Low preset at 1440p yields 136 FPS, which is nearly 64% higher than the High preset's output at the same resolution. However, the visual compromise in a game like Evolve, which relies on environmental awareness, might be substantial. The Medium preset at 1440p provides a middle ground at 105 FPS, but the 22 FPS advantage over High comes with noticeable graphical downgrades. The High preset appears to be the sweet spot, as it maintains a fluid experience while keeping the visual fidelity high enough to spot threats in the dense jungle environments.
At 4K, the situation changes dramatically. The High preset manages only 47 FPS, which is below the ideal threshold for a competitive FPS. The Medium preset at 4K achieves exactly 60 FPS, with a minimum of 51 and a maximum of 69, indicating some variability but generally playable performance. For 4K users, the Medium preset appears to be the most viable option, as Low at 77 FPS sacrifices too much visual detail for a game that relies on atmospheric tension. The Ultra preset at 4K is not recommended, as the 33 FPS average falls below acceptable playability standards for this genre.
The data implies a clear recommendation: for 1080p and 1440p displays, use the High preset for the best balance of visual quality and performance. For 4K displays, stepping down to Medium is necessary to maintain a playable experience. The measured results show a consistent pattern where the gap between High and Ultra is disproportionately large compared to the gap between Medium and High, suggesting that the Ultra preset includes settings that are particularly demanding on this GPU configuration.

Measured FPS Breakdown
At 1920x1080, the measured FPS values show a clear progression from Low to Ultra. The Low preset achieves an average of 203 FPS, which is exceptionally high and indicates that the system is CPU-bound at this settings level. The Medium preset delivers 157 FPS with a minimum of 134 and a maximum of 181, showing strong consistency. The High preset drops to 123 FPS, while the Ultra preset falls to 85 FPS. The scaling from Low to Ultra at 1080p shows a 58% reduction in frame rate, which is substantial but still leaves the Ultra preset at a playable level.
Moving to 2560x1440, the frame rates decrease as expected. The Low preset at 1440p achieves 136 FPS, which is 33% lower than the 1080p Low result. The Medium preset delivers 105 FPS with a minimum of 90 and a maximum of 121, maintaining good consistency. The High preset at 1440p yields 83 FPS, while the Ultra preset falls to 57 FPS. The scaling from 1080p to 1440p at High settings shows a 33% reduction, which is consistent with the pixel count increase of approximately 78%, indicating that the GPU is not purely pixel-bound at this resolution.
At 3840x2160, the performance drops significantly. The Low preset achieves 77 FPS, which is 43% lower than the 1440p Low result. The Medium preset at 4K delivers exactly 60 FPS with a minimum of 51 and a maximum of 69, showing some frame time variance. The High preset falls to 47 FPS, while the Ultra preset bottoms out at 33 FPS. The scaling from 1440p to 4K at High settings shows a 43% reduction, which is less than the 125% pixel count increase, suggesting that other factors such as memory bandwidth are starting to play a more significant role.
